First on the list are dumplings, which are a staple in best Chinese cuisine. These bite-sized delights are typically made with a thin dough wrapper and filled with a variety of ingredients. They can be steamed, boiled, or pan-fried and come in numerous flavors such as pork, shrimp, chicken, or vegetarian options. Dumplings are not only delicious but also have cultural significance, especially during the Chinese New Year when families gather to make and enjoy them for good luck and prosperity.

If you are a fan of spicy food, then Sichuan cuisine is a must-try. Sichuan cuisine is known for its bold flavors and use of Sichuan peppercorns that provide a unique numbing sensation. One of the must-try dishes from this region is Mapo Tofu. It is a spicy and savory dish that consists of tofu cubes cooked in a fiery chili bean sauce. The combination of the soft tofu, aromatic spices, and numbing Sichuan peppercorns creates an explosion of flavors that will leave you craving for more.

Another iconic Chinese delicacy is Peking duck. This renowned dish has a history dating back to the imperial era and is considered a symbol of Chinese cuisine. Peking duck is known for its crispy skin, tender meat, and rich flavor. The duck is typically roasted in a special oven, and the skin is painstakingly prepared to achieve that perfect crispy texture. The slices of succulent duck meat, along with spring onions, cucumber, and hoisin sauce, are then wrapped in thin pancakes, creating a delightful combination of flavors and textures.

If you are looking for a vegetarian option, then look no further than Buddha's Delight. This popular dish is a vegetarian's delight, with a colorful array of vegetables, mushrooms, and tofu cooked in a flavorful sauce. The dish is not only visually appealing but also packed with nutrients. It is believed to have been created by Buddhist monks who strictly followed a vegetarian diet. Buddha's Delight is a perfect example of how Chinese cuisine caters to the diverse dietary preferences of its people.

Lastly, no list of Chinese delicacies is complete without mentioning dim sum. Dim sum is a style of Chinese cuisine where small bite-sized portions of food are served in steamer baskets or on small plates. Dim sum is often enjoyed during brunch or lunch and is a social dining experience, where friends and family gather to share these delectable treats. Some popular dim sum dishes include shrimp dumplings, pork buns, sticky rice wrapped in lotus leaves, and egg tarts. The variety of flavors, textures, and fillings in dim sum make it a must-try Chinese culinary experience.
